Webyellow-bellied flycatcher, builds an enclosed nest on the ground. The familiar eastern phoebe plasters its nest against a rock wall or on a building rafter. And the great crested flycatcher uses a tree cavity. In most cases, the female does most or all of the incubating, while the male defends the nesting territory and helps feed the young. WebGreat Crested Flycatchers are large flycatchers that are around 6.7–8.3 inches in length, with a wingspan of roughly 13.4 inches. The average weight of these birds ranges from 0.9–1.4 ounces. They have long and lean proportions, with a powerful build, broad shoulders, and a larger head. Their crest is not particularly prominent in size.

Picture 1 of 3. database challenges as a testerWebGreat Crested Flycatchers are large flycatchers with fairly long and lean proportions. Like many flycatchers they have a powerful build with broad shoulders and a large head. Despite its name, this bird’s crest is not especially prominent.
